Transaction 43b241d08fee7909557485b2e58959faa405ea24497513517988193ceb2e4f11
1 Input
1 Output
-
43b241d08fee7909557485b2e58959faa405ea24497513517988193ceb2e4f11:0
- value
- 55358006
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4bc454bd484e21177a8f0666f134f2a13bc65d78 OP_EQUAL
- address
- 38bdoFPq5Zj6VACV5CfCFeYvechZApCmZ5